Hamburger SV's last away win against Borussia Dortmund was in 2014.
During the last 57 meetings, Borussia Dortmund have won 30 times, there have been 12 draws while Hamburger SV have won 15 times. The goal difference is 101-71 in favour of Borussia Dortmund.
During the last 26 meetings with Borussia Dortmund playing at home, Borussia Dortmund have won 16 times, there have been 4 draws while Hamburger SV have won 6 times. The goal difference is 45-26 in favour of Borussia Dortmund.
The most common result of matches between Borussia Dortmund and Hamburger SV is 1-1. 8 matches have ended with this result.
